About Mirakl

Mirakl is the leading provider of eCommerce software solutions. Mirakl's suite of solutions provides enterprises with a transformative way to drive significant growth and efficiency in their online business.
 
Since 2012, Mirakl has been pioneering the platform economy, empowering retail and b2b enterprises with the most advanced, secure and scalable technology to digitize and expand product assortment through marketplace and dropship, improve efficiency in supplier catalog management and payments, personalize shopping experiences, and boost profits through retail media.

Mirakl is trusted by Macy’s, Saks, Henry Schein, The Knot, 1800-Flowers, Best Buy, Lowe's, Ulta and 450+ industry-leading businesses worldwide. For more information: www.mirakl.com.

 

We are seeking a motivated and detail-oriented Associate, Public Affairs & Corporate Communications to support the development and execution of Mirakl’s' integrated communications and public affairs strategy. You will play a key role in crafting compelling corporate narratives, managing external communications, monitoring and influencing policy developments, and building strategic relationships with media, stakeholders, and policymakers. This position ensures that Mirakl is well-positioned both in public discourse and regulatory discussions around retail media, and digital marketplaces.

You’ll be joining a team of 3 professionals leading Mirakl’s communications & policy efforts globally.

What You’ll Do at Mirakl:

  • Policy Monitoring & Communications: Track, analyze, and report on relevant legislation, regulatory developments, and political trends related to advertising, digital media, e-commerce, and retail marketplaces. Transform complex policy insights into clear communications for internal and external audiences.
  • Stakeholder Engagement & Media Relations: Support the development of relationships with key stakeholders including policymakers, industry associations, public institutions, journalists, and thought leaders, ensuring Mirakl's interests and brand narrative are effectively represented across all channels.
  • Advocacy & Thought Leadership: Contribute to the preparation of policy papers, reports, presentations, press releases, and thought leadership content to communicate Mirakl's positions on relevant issues to regulators, lawmakers, industry bodies, and the broader public through media channels.
  • Research, Analysis & Content Development: Conduct research on public policy topics and industry trends affecting digital advertising and retail media, providing insights to inform business strategy, policy positioning, and corporate messaging. Develop compelling content for various communication channels.
  • Event Management & Public Representation: Organise events, media briefings, press conferences, and public-facing engagements. Represent Mirakl at industry forums, policy discussions, and trade association.
  • Crisis Communications & Reputation Management: Monitor public sentiment and media coverage related to regulatory and industry issues. Support crisis communication efforts and proactive reputation management initiatives.
  • Internal Coordination & Strategic Communications: Work closely with the Corporate Affairs & Impact team and other departments such as Legal, Communications, Product, and Marketing teams to ensure alignment on public affairs activities and consistent corporate messaging across all touchpoints.

Qualifications:

  • Masters degree in Public Affairs, Political Science, Communications, Law, or a related field.
  • 2-4 years of experience in public affairs, government relations, or regulatory affairs, ideally within the advertising, digital media, or e-commerce sectors.
  • Strong understanding of regulatory environments, particularly those related to advertising, media, and e-commerce.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to synthesise complex regulatory issues into clear messaging.
  • Collaborative communication skills, with the ability to build and maintain relationships with diverse stakeholders.
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ment, manage multiple projects, and prioritise effectively.
  • Fluency in French and English is required; other languages are a plus.
